It’s time consuming, costly, and difficult for farmers to measure and regulate pH levels in their plants throughout the day and across the lifecycle of a plant. Indeed, pH levels are one of the key factors in plant health. Join Jerry Nixon as he welcomes the team from Costa Farms and Microsoft as they describe how they developed an Azure IoT Hub solution with pH sensor devices that incorporates Stream Analytics, Twilio and SQL Azure, where the end result will help Costa Farms increase revenue and profitability by using modern technology in agriculture & farming.
